Cajun Boiled Peanuts
Ingredients
The peanuts
-
24
oz
raw peanuts or green peanuts
The seasoning
-
1-2
teaspoons
Cajun Seasoning
-
to taste
salt
-
water
water
Instructions
- Rinse the raw peanuts under cold water.
- Place the peanuts in a large pot and cover them with water, ensuring the water level is at least 2 inches above the peanuts.
- Add the Cajun seasoning and salt to the pot, then stir and taste the water to adjust the spices.
- Bring the water to a boil over high heat.
- Once boiling, reduce the heat to medium-low and cover the pot with a lid.
- Let the peanuts simmer for about 1.5 to 2 hours, checking for tenderness periodically.
- If the water level drops too low, add more water to keep the peanuts submerged.
- Taste the peanuts occasionally to check for doneness.
- Once cooked to your liking, remove the pot from heat and drain the peanuts.
